    Who is a CyberSec-Practitioner?

    A CyberSec-Practitioner is a trained expert in identifying vulnerabilities, preventing cyberattacks, responding to incidents, and designing secure systems. They combine technical prowess with strategic thinking, ensuring that networks, devices, data, and applications remain resilient against ever-evolving cyber threats. Their work extends beyond technical measures — they also educate users, create policies, and align cybersecurity initiatives with business goals.

    Core Responsibilities

    A CyberSec-Practitioner typically juggles a wide variety of tasks:

    • Risk Assessment: Evaluating vulnerabilities across systems and networks to identify potential threats.
    • Threat Mitigation: Designing and implementing defensive strategies to block cyberattacks before they happen.
    • Incident Response: Acting swiftly when a breach occurs — containing the threat, analyzing the breach, and recommending improvements.
    • Security Architecture: Building secure infrastructures, including firewalls, VPNs, encryption protocols, and authentication systems.
    • Compliance and Governance: Ensuring that organizations comply with industry standards like GDPR, HIPAA, and ISO 27001.
    • User Education: Training non-technical staff about safe digital practices, phishing scams, and data privacy.

    Skills Every CyberSec-Practitioner Needs

    A CyberSec-Practitioner must master a diverse skill set to stay relevant:

    • Technical Expertise: Proficiency in network security, encryption, programming (Python, C, Java), cloud security, and ethical hacking.
    • Analytical Thinking: Ability to assess risks, predict attack vectors, and think like a hacker.
    • Problem Solving: Quick decision-making and innovative solutions in high-pressure scenarios.
    • Communication Skills: Translating complex security concepts into actionable advice for executives, staff, and clients.
    • Continuous Learning: Cybersecurity is a constantly evolving field; practitioners must stay updated through training, certifications, and hands-on experience.

    Certifications That Matter

    Certifications provide a critical pathway to gaining credibility and staying competitive. Common ones include:

    • Certified Information Systems Security Professional (CISSP)
    • Certified Ethical Hacker (CEH)
    • CompTIA Security+
    • Certified Cloud Security Professional (CCSP)
    • Certified Information Security Manager (CISM)

    Many CyberSec-Practitioners also pursue niche certifications focused on cloud, forensics, penetration testing, or governance.

    Challenges CyberSec-Practitioners Face

    Despite their expertise, CyberSec-Practitioners operate in a highly challenging environment:

    • Advanced Persistent Threats (APTs): Highly sophisticated attacks that are stealthy and targeted.
    • Zero-Day Vulnerabilities: Exploits that hackers discover before vendors can patch them.
    • Human Error: Even the best technical defenses can be undone by an employee clicking a malicious link.
    • Resource Constraints: Many security teams are underfunded or understaffed.
    • Rapid Technology Change: AI, IoT, quantum computing — each innovation creates new vulnerabilities.

    Dealing with these requires resilience, adaptability, and a proactive mindset.
